Lepperton, at Lepperton. Inglewood v. Eltham, at Eltham. NEWS AND NOTES. Football enthusiasts will be given a taste today of the football that is in store for them this season, when two club matches will be played, viz., Tukapa v. Star, at Western Park, in a benefit match, and Hawera v. Imlay (Wanganui), at Hawera. Both matches will attract attention, and should provide good games. Star has a greatly improved team this season, and expects to fully extend its formidable rival. As both teams have been in active training for several weeks past, they should give a bright exhibition to the finish. South Taranaki is promised a great struggle at Hawera, when the local team, who have been champions of Taranaki for the past couple of seasons, will meet Imlay, the Wanganui champions. Hawera possesses a wellbalanced team, both backs and forwards being capable of good work, and as Imlay are also strong in both departments, the game should be exciting. Next Saturday will see the game start in real earnest in Taranaki, as the cup fixtures commence on that date. Players should take the field in better condition than has been the ease for several years past, and teams should show better combination, as not only have members devoted great attention to training, but the various seven-aside tournaments that have been held have been of great service in the matter of concerted play. The standard of play shown in these tournaments has been splendid, and augurs well for the game during the coming season.
Opunake has added further to its laurels by winning against strong company at Manaia last week; Indeed, the final between Clifton and Opunake is said to have been the best ever witnessed on the ground, being fast and open. Opunake just snatched the victory, but it was a well deserved one, for even though they had the luck of the draw, they have been training hard and have taken up the game seriously. ’The presence of Ifwerson, the New Zealand representative, in the coastal team has strengthened them beyond all knowledge. Cool, clever and resourceful, both as a player and a captain, he has some great material of keen young players to work on, and already a decided improvement is noticeable. This team will be hard to beat, and should nearly achieve the championship honors. . Opunake had bad luck last year In losing a lot of players early in the season through accident, and this year they have already lost one—Duffy, a very promising five-eighths, having been very seriously injured while returning home through a dray colliding with the car in which he was travelling. All footballers will wish this fine young player a speedy recovery, but it is certain he will be unable to take the field again. Clifton put in a good seven. Hickey was playing in great form, as were also Ross, Fryday and Jones, whilst in the ex-Welllngtonlan Tancred, they possess a great forward of the hard, rugged type, and with a fine knowledge of the game. Clifton also promise to play their usual prominent part in the settlement of the championship. Hawera had a strong side, but some of the players appeared to lack condition. Purcell, a new arrival from the East Coast, promises to be a welcome acquisition. With Robertson, Walshe, Wilkinson, and Hughes in good form Hawera should be stronger than ever in the rearguard, whilst their forwards will be all Blrchall and Taylor showed good form for Waimate. This club may be on the weak side this year, as is also Okaiawa, and there is a probability of the two clubs amalgamating. Eltham put in a team, and though the members shaped fairly well, they were beaten by a fairly strong Opunake B team, Opunake also won a tournament at Cape Egmont sports on Wednesday, but the opposition there was weak. Norgate, the ex-Taranaki "hooker,” led a Kaliui Road team. The veteran still shows good form, and will don the Opunake jersey this year. With the added number of teams entered in the competitions this year, there will be a lot of work for the Referees’ Association. However, with the formation of the central division and the acquisition of several new men in the northern division, it is expected that there will be no difficulty in fulfilling all engagements. There is still room for further additions to the ranks of referees. It is pleasing to note that the Referees' Association intends to be strict in enforcing the rule compelling players to take the field in their proper uniforms. Nothing looks worse than to see a team come out arrayed In all the colors of a rainbow, and during the past few seasons there have certainly been some wonderful kaleidoscopic effects. There has, perhaps, been a little excuse during and since the war, owinig to the difficulty In securing the requisite jerseys, but that difficulty has now passed.
